The Late-Night Appeal of AudiobooksFor night owls, the midnight hours offer a rare slice of uninterrupted peace. While the rest of the world sleeps, nocturnal minds wake up, seeking entertainment that matches the quiet stillness of the night. Screen time can disrupt sleep cycles, making television or reading on a bright tablet less than ideal. This is where audiobooks become the perfect late-night companion. They allow you to immerse yourself in a gripping story or learn something new, all while resting your eyes in a dimly lit room. Finding the right narration can transform your sleepless hours into a deeply comforting routine.

However, feeding a late-night audiobook habit can quickly become expensive. When you regularly burn through multiple books a week, standard retail prices or high-cost monthly subscriptions start to add up. Fortunately, the digital landscape is filled with budget-friendly options that deliver premium entertainment without the premium price tag. By exploring alternative platforms and smart purchasing strategies, you can build an endless nighttime library that keeps your wallet happy.

Smart Ways to Listen on a BudgetThe secret to affordable listening lies in knowing where to look beyond the mainstream storefronts. Public libraries are the absolute best starting point for any budget-conscious night owl. By using free applications like Libby or Hoopla, you can connect your local library card to your smartphone and gain instant access to thousands of digital audiobooks. There are no monthly fees, no hidden costs, and books return themselves automatically, ensuring you never face a late fee.

For books that you want to own permanently, credit-based subscription models with rotating sales offer incredible value. Services like Chirp Audiobooks focus on flash deals, providing popular titles for just a few dollars with no recurring monthly commitment. Additionally, platforms like Libro.fm support independent bookstores while offering competitive membership pricing. If you enjoy classic literature, platforms like LibriVox offer completely free, public-domain audiobooks recorded by volunteers, which are perfect for a vintage late-night vibe.

Immersive Fiction for the Midnight HoursWhen selecting the best affordable audiobooks for nighttime, genre and narration style matter immensely. Atmospheric fiction tends to thrive in the dark. Detailed fantasy world-building, slow-burn mystery novels, and gothic horror stories feel amplified when the world outside is silent. Look for titles with single-narrator performances that use a calm, measured pace. A voice that is too frantic or accompanied by loud sound effects can jar you out of your relaxed state.

Affordable classics are an excellent choice for this time of day. Listening to a lengthy Victorian mystery or a sprawling sci-fi epic provides dozens of hours of entertainment for the price of a single credit. The complex language and steady rhythm of older prose often act as a soothing mechanism, helping an overactive mind wind down naturally while still keeping the imagination fully engaged.

Non-Fiction and Calming NarrationsIf fiction is not your preference, late-night non-fiction offers a wonderful alternative. Memoirs read by the authors themselves create an intimate, conversational atmosphere that feels like a late-night chat with a friend. Look for biographies of historical figures, gentle nature writing, or philosophical essays. These genres expand your knowledge without triggering the adrenaline spike that a high-stakes thriller might induce.

Science and history audiobooks with deep-voiced narrators are particularly popular among night owls. The steady explanation of astrophysics, ancient civilizations, or oceanography can be deeply fascinating yet profoundly relaxing. Many listeners find that focusing on a narrator’s smooth delivery of educational facts helps distract from daytime anxieties, making it much easier to eventually drift off to sleep.

Maximizing Your Late-Night Listening ExperienceTo get the most out of your budget-friendly audiobooks, a few simple adjustments to your listening habits can make a major difference. Always utilize the sleep timer function available in almost every modern audiobook application. Setting the audio to automatically turn off after thirty or forty-five minutes ensures that you do not lose your place if you fall asleep mid-chapter, saving you the frustration of hunting for your spot the next night.

Investing in a comfortable pair of sleep-approved headphones or utilizing a small bedside bluetooth speaker at a low volume can also enhance your comfort. Keeping the narration just loud enough to hear clearly prevents strain while maintaining a peaceful environment. With the right setup and a steady stream of affordable titles, your nocturnal hours can become the most relaxing and enriching part of your day.
